Prepare for radical source tree reorganization.zack/build-layout-experiment
All top-level files and directories are moved into a temporary storage directory, REORG.TODO, except for files that will certainly still exist in their current form at top level when we're done (COPYING, COPYING.LIB, LICENSES, NEWS, README), all old ChangeLog files (which are moved to the new directory OldChangeLogs, instead), and the generated file INSTALL (which is just deleted; in the new order, there will be no generated files checked into version control).

+#ifndef _NETINET_ETHER_H
+#define _NETINET_ETHER_H 1
+
+#include <features.h>
+
+/* Get definition of `struct ether_addr'. */
+#include <netinet/if_ether.h>
+
+#ifdef __USE_MISC
+__BEGIN_DECLS
+
+/* Convert 48 bit Ethernet ADDRess to ASCII. */
+extern char *ether_ntoa (const struct ether_addr *__addr) __THROW;
+extern char *ether_ntoa_r (const struct ether_addr *__addr, char *__buf)
+ __THROW;
+
+/* Convert ASCII string S to 48 bit Ethernet address. */
+extern struct ether_addr *ether_aton (const char *__asc) __THROW;
+extern struct ether_addr *ether_aton_r (const char *__asc,
+ struct ether_addr *__addr) __THROW;
+
+/* Map 48 bit Ethernet number ADDR to HOSTNAME. */
+extern int ether_ntohost (char *__hostname, const struct ether_addr *__addr)
+ __THROW;
+
+/* Map HOSTNAME to 48 bit Ethernet address. */
+extern int ether_hostton (const char *__hostname, struct ether_addr *__addr)
+ __THROW;
+
+/* Scan LINE and set ADDR and HOSTNAME. */
+extern int ether_line (const char *__line, struct ether_addr *__addr,
+ char *__hostname) __THROW;
+
+__END_DECLS
+#endif /* Use misc. */
+
+#endif /* netinet/ether.h */

+__BEGIN_DECLS
+
+/* Internet address. */
+typedef uint32_t in_addr_t;
+struct in_addr
+ {
+ in_addr_t s_addr;
+ };
+
+/* Get system-specific definitions. */
+#include <bits/in.h>
+
+/* Standard well-defined IP protocols. */
+enum
+ {
+ IPPROTO_IP = 0, /* Dummy protocol for TCP. */
+#define IPPROTO_IP IPPROTO_IP
+ IPPROTO_ICMP = 1, /* Internet Control Message Protocol. */
+#define IPPROTO_ICMP IPPROTO_ICMP
+ IPPROTO_IGMP = 2, /* Internet Group Management Protocol. */
+#define IPPROTO_IGMP IPPROTO_IGMP
+ IPPROTO_IPIP = 4, /* IPIP tunnels (older KA9Q tunnels use 94). */
+#define IPPROTO_IPIP IPPROTO_IPIP
+ IPPROTO_TCP = 6, /* Transmission Control Protocol. */
+#define IPPROTO_TCP IPPROTO_TCP
+ IPPROTO_EGP = 8, /* Exterior Gateway Protocol. */
+#define IPPROTO_EGP IPPROTO_EGP
+ IPPROTO_PUP = 12, /* PUP protocol. */
+#define IPPROTO_PUP IPPROTO_PUP
+ IPPROTO_UDP = 17, /* User Datagram Protocol. */
+#define IPPROTO_UDP IPPROTO_UDP
+ IPPROTO_IDP = 22, /* XNS IDP protocol. */
+#define IPPROTO_IDP IPPROTO_IDP
+ IPPROTO_TP = 29, /* SO Transport Protocol Class 4. */
+#define IPPROTO_TP IPPROTO_TP
+ IPPROTO_DCCP = 33, /* Datagram Congestion Control Protocol. */
+#define IPPROTO_DCCP IPPROTO_DCCP
+ IPPROTO_IPV6 = 41, /* IPv6 header. */
+#define IPPROTO_IPV6 IPPROTO_IPV6
+ IPPROTO_RSVP = 46, /* Reservation Protocol. */
+#define IPPROTO_RSVP IPPROTO_RSVP
+ IPPROTO_GRE = 47, /* General Routing Encapsulation. */
+#define IPPROTO_GRE IPPROTO_GRE
+ IPPROTO_ESP = 50, /* encapsulating security payload. */
+#define IPPROTO_ESP IPPROTO_ESP
+ IPPROTO_AH = 51, /* authentication header. */
+#define IPPROTO_AH IPPROTO_AH
+ IPPROTO_MTP = 92, /* Multicast Transport Protocol. */
+#define IPPROTO_MTP IPPROTO_MTP
+ IPPROTO_BEETPH = 94, /* IP option pseudo header for BEET. */
+#define IPPROTO_BEETPH IPPROTO_BEETPH
+ IPPROTO_ENCAP = 98, /* Encapsulation Header. */
+#define IPPROTO_ENCAP IPPROTO_ENCAP
+ IPPROTO_PIM = 103, /* Protocol Independent Multicast. */
+#define IPPROTO_PIM IPPROTO_PIM
+ IPPROTO_COMP = 108, /* Compression Header Protocol. */
+#define IPPROTO_COMP IPPROTO_COMP
+ IPPROTO_SCTP = 132, /* Stream Control Transmission Protocol. */
+#define IPPROTO_SCTP IPPROTO_SCTP
+ IPPROTO_UDPLITE = 136, /* UDP-Lite protocol. */
+#define IPPROTO_UDPLITE IPPROTO_UDPLITE
+ IPPROTO_MPLS = 137, /* MPLS in IP. */
+#define IPPROTO_MPLS IPPROTO_MPLS
+ IPPROTO_RAW = 255, /* Raw IP packets. */
+#define IPPROTO_RAW IPPROTO_RAW
+ IPPROTO_MAX
+ };
+
+/* If __USE_KERNEL_IPV6_DEFS is 1 then the user has included the kernel
+ network headers first and we should use those ABI-identical definitions
+ instead of our own, otherwise 0. */
+#if !__USE_KERNEL_IPV6_DEFS
+enum
+ {
+ IPPROTO_HOPOPTS = 0, /* IPv6 Hop-by-Hop options. */
+#define IPPROTO_HOPOPTS IPPROTO_HOPOPTS
+ IPPROTO_ROUTING = 43, /* IPv6 routing header. */
+#define IPPROTO_ROUTING IPPROTO_ROUTING
+ IPPROTO_FRAGMENT = 44, /* IPv6 fragmentation header. */
+#define IPPROTO_FRAGMENT IPPROTO_FRAGMENT
+ IPPROTO_ICMPV6 = 58, /* ICMPv6. */
+#define IPPROTO_ICMPV6 IPPROTO_ICMPV6
+ IPPROTO_NONE = 59, /* IPv6 no next header. */
+#define IPPROTO_NONE IPPROTO_NONE
+ IPPROTO_DSTOPTS = 60, /* IPv6 destination options. */
+#define IPPROTO_DSTOPTS IPPROTO_DSTOPTS
+ IPPROTO_MH = 135 /* IPv6 mobility header. */
+#define IPPROTO_MH IPPROTO_MH
+ };
+#endif /* !__USE_KERNEL_IPV6_DEFS */
+
+/* Type to represent a port. */
+typedef uint16_t in_port_t;
+
+/* Standard well-known ports. */
+enum
+ {
+ IPPORT_ECHO = 7, /* Echo service. */
+ IPPORT_DISCARD = 9, /* Discard transmissions service. */
+ IPPORT_SYSTAT = 11, /* System status service. */
+ IPPORT_DAYTIME = 13, /* Time of day service. */
+ IPPORT_NETSTAT = 15, /* Network status service. */
+ IPPORT_FTP = 21, /* File Transfer Protocol. */
+ IPPORT_TELNET = 23, /* Telnet protocol. */
+ IPPORT_SMTP = 25, /* Simple Mail Transfer Protocol. */
+ IPPORT_TIMESERVER = 37, /* Timeserver service. */
+ IPPORT_NAMESERVER = 42, /* Domain Name Service. */
+ IPPORT_WHOIS = 43, /* Internet Whois service. */
+ IPPORT_MTP = 57,
+
+ IPPORT_TFTP = 69, /* Trivial File Transfer Protocol. */
+ IPPORT_RJE = 77,
+ IPPORT_FINGER = 79, /* Finger service. */
+ IPPORT_TTYLINK = 87,
+ IPPORT_SUPDUP = 95, /* SUPDUP protocol. */
+
+
+ IPPORT_EXECSERVER = 512, /* execd service. */
+ IPPORT_LOGINSERVER = 513, /* rlogind service. */
+ IPPORT_CMDSERVER = 514,
+ IPPORT_EFSSERVER = 520,
+
+ /* UDP ports. */
+ IPPORT_BIFFUDP = 512,
+ IPPORT_WHOSERVER = 513,
+ IPPORT_ROUTESERVER = 520,
+
+ /* Ports less than this value are reserved for privileged processes. */
+ IPPORT_RESERVED = 1024,
+
+ /* Ports greater this value are reserved for (non-privileged) servers. */
+ IPPORT_USERRESERVED = 5000
+ };
+
+/* Definitions of the bits in an Internet address integer.
+
+ On subnets, host and network parts are found according to
+ the subnet mask, not these masks. */
+
+#define IN_CLASSA(a) ((((in_addr_t)(a)) & 0x80000000) == 0)
+#define IN_CLASSA_NET 0xff000000
+#define IN_CLASSA_NSHIFT 24
+#define IN_CLASSA_HOST (0xffffffff & ~IN_CLASSA_NET)
+#define IN_CLASSA_MAX 128
+
+#define IN_CLASSB(a) ((((in_addr_t)(a)) & 0xc0000000) == 0x80000000)
+#define IN_CLASSB_NET 0xffff0000
+#define IN_CLASSB_NSHIFT 16
+#define IN_CLASSB_HOST (0xffffffff & ~IN_CLASSB_NET)
+#define IN_CLASSB_MAX 65536
+
+#define IN_CLASSC(a) ((((in_addr_t)(a)) & 0xe0000000) == 0xc0000000)
+#define IN_CLASSC_NET 0xffffff00
+#define IN_CLASSC_NSHIFT 8
+#define IN_CLASSC_HOST (0xffffffff & ~IN_CLASSC_NET)
+
+#define IN_CLASSD(a) ((((in_addr_t)(a)) & 0xf0000000) == 0xe0000000)
+#define IN_MULTICAST(a) IN_CLASSD(a)
+
+#define IN_EXPERIMENTAL(a) ((((in_addr_t)(a)) & 0xe0000000) == 0xe0000000)
+#define IN_BADCLASS(a) ((((in_addr_t)(a)) & 0xf0000000) == 0xf0000000)
+
+/* Address to accept any incoming messages. */
+#define INADDR_ANY ((in_addr_t) 0x00000000)
+/* Address to send to all hosts. */
+#define INADDR_BROADCAST ((in_addr_t) 0xffffffff)
+/* Address indicating an error return. */
+#define INADDR_NONE ((in_addr_t) 0xffffffff)
+
+/* Network number for local host loopback. */
+#define IN_LOOPBACKNET 127
+/* Address to loopback in software to local host. */
+#ifndef INADDR_LOOPBACK
+# define INADDR_LOOPBACK ((in_addr_t) 0x7f000001) /* Inet 127.0.0.1. */
+#endif
+
+/* Defines for Multicast INADDR. */
+#define INADDR_UNSPEC_GROUP ((in_addr_t) 0xe0000000) /* 224.0.0.0 */
+#define INADDR_ALLHOSTS_GROUP ((in_addr_t) 0xe0000001) /* 224.0.0.1 */
+#define INADDR_ALLRTRS_GROUP ((in_addr_t) 0xe0000002) /* 224.0.0.2 */
+#define INADDR_MAX_LOCAL_GROUP ((in_addr_t) 0xe00000ff) /* 224.0.0.255 */
+
+#if !__USE_KERNEL_IPV6_DEFS
+/* IPv6 address */
+struct in6_addr
+ {
+ union
+ {
+ uint8_t __u6_addr8[16];
+ uint16_t __u6_addr16[8];
+ uint32_t __u6_addr32[4];
+ } __in6_u;
+#define s6_addr __in6_u.__u6_addr8
+#ifdef __USE_MISC
+# define s6_addr16 __in6_u.__u6_addr16
+# define s6_addr32 __in6_u.__u6_addr32
+#endif
+ };
+#endif /* !__USE_KERNEL_IPV6_DEFS */
+
+extern const struct in6_addr in6addr_any; /* :: */
+extern const struct in6_addr in6addr_loopback; /* ::1 */
+#define IN6ADDR_ANY_INIT { { { 0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0 } } }
+#define IN6ADDR_LOOPBACK_INIT { { { 0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,0,1 } } }
+
+#define INET_ADDRSTRLEN 16
+#define INET6_ADDRSTRLEN 46
+

+/* Functions to convert between host and network byte order.
+
+ Please note that these functions normally take `unsigned long int' or
+ `unsigned short int' values as arguments and also return them. But
+ this was a short-sighted decision since on different systems the types
+ may have different representations but the values are always the same. */
+
+extern uint32_t ntohl (uint32_t __netlong) __THROW __attribute__ ((__const__));
+extern uint16_t ntohs (uint16_t __netshort)
+ __THROW __attribute__ ((__const__));
+extern uint32_t htonl (uint32_t __hostlong)
+ __THROW __attribute__ ((__const__));
+extern uint16_t htons (uint16_t __hostshort)
+ __THROW __attribute__ ((__const__));
+
+#include <endian.h>
+
+/* Get machine dependent optimized versions of byte swapping functions. */
+#include <bits/byteswap.h>
+#include <bits/uintn-identity.h>
+
+#ifdef __OPTIMIZE__
+/* We can optimize calls to the conversion functions. Either nothing has
+ to be done or we are using directly the byte-swapping functions which
+ often can be inlined. */
+# if __BYTE_ORDER == __BIG_ENDIAN
+/* The host byte order is the same as network byte order,
+ so these functions are all just identity. */
+# define ntohl(x) __uint32_identity (x)
+# define ntohs(x) __uint16_identity (x)
+# define htonl(x) __uint32_identity (x)
+# define htons(x) __uint16_identity (x)
+# else
+# if __BYTE_ORDER == __LITTLE_ENDIAN
+# define ntohl(x) __bswap_32 (x)
+# define ntohs(x) __bswap_16 (x)
+# define htonl(x) __bswap_32 (x)
+# define htons(x) __bswap_16 (x)
+# endif
+# endif
+#endif

+#ifndef _NETINET_IP6_H
+#define _NETINET_IP6_H 1
+
+#include <inttypes.h>
+#include <netinet/in.h>
+
+struct ip6_hdr
+ {
+ union
+ {
+ struct ip6_hdrctl
+ {
+ uint32_t ip6_un1_flow; /* 4 bits version, 8 bits TC,
+ 20 bits flow-ID */
+ uint16_t ip6_un1_plen; /* payload length */
+ uint8_t ip6_un1_nxt; /* next header */
+ uint8_t ip6_un1_hlim; /* hop limit */
+ } ip6_un1;
+ uint8_t ip6_un2_vfc; /* 4 bits version, top 4 bits tclass */
+ } ip6_ctlun;
+ struct in6_addr ip6_src; /* source address */
+ struct in6_addr ip6_dst; /* destination address */
+ };
+
+#define ip6_vfc ip6_ctlun.ip6_un2_vfc
+#define ip6_flow ip6_ctlun.ip6_un1.ip6_un1_flow
+#define ip6_plen ip6_ctlun.ip6_un1.ip6_un1_plen
+#define ip6_nxt ip6_ctlun.ip6_un1.ip6_un1_nxt
+#define ip6_hlim ip6_ctlun.ip6_un1.ip6_un1_hlim
+#define ip6_hops ip6_ctlun.ip6_un1.ip6_un1_hlim
+
+/* Generic extension header. */
+struct ip6_ext
+ {
+ uint8_t ip6e_nxt; /* next header. */
+ uint8_t ip6e_len; /* length in units of 8 octets. */
+ };
+
+/* Hop-by-Hop options header. */
+struct ip6_hbh
+ {
+ uint8_t ip6h_nxt; /* next header. */
+ uint8_t ip6h_len; /* length in units of 8 octets. */
+ /* followed by options */
+ };
+
+/* Destination options header */
+struct ip6_dest
+ {
+ uint8_t ip6d_nxt; /* next header */
+ uint8_t ip6d_len; /* length in units of 8 octets */
+ /* followed by options */
+ };
+
+/* Routing header */
+struct ip6_rthdr
+ {
+ uint8_t ip6r_nxt; /* next header */
+ uint8_t ip6r_len; /* length in units of 8 octets */
+ uint8_t ip6r_type; /* routing type */
+ uint8_t ip6r_segleft; /* segments left */
+ /* followed by routing type specific data */
+ };
+
+/* Type 0 Routing header */
+struct ip6_rthdr0
+ {
+ uint8_t ip6r0_nxt; /* next header */
+ uint8_t ip6r0_len; /* length in units of 8 octets */
+ uint8_t ip6r0_type; /* always zero */
+ uint8_t ip6r0_segleft; /* segments left */
+ uint8_t ip6r0_reserved; /* reserved field */
+ uint8_t ip6r0_slmap[3]; /* strict/loose bit map */
+ /* followed by up to 127 struct in6_addr */
+ struct in6_addr ip6r0_addr[0];
+ };
+
+/* Fragment header */
+struct ip6_frag
+ {
+ uint8_t ip6f_nxt; /* next header */
+ uint8_t ip6f_reserved; /* reserved field */
+ uint16_t ip6f_offlg; /* offset, reserved, and flag */
+ uint32_t ip6f_ident; /* identification */
+ };
+
+#if __BYTE_ORDER == __BIG_ENDIAN
+# define IP6F_OFF_MASK 0xfff8 /* mask out offset from _offlg */
+# define IP6F_RESERVED_MASK 0x0006 /* reserved bits in ip6f_offlg */
+# define IP6F_MORE_FRAG 0x0001 /* more-fragments flag */
+#else /* __BYTE_ORDER == __LITTLE_ENDIAN */
+# define IP6F_OFF_MASK 0xf8ff /* mask out offset from _offlg */
+# define IP6F_RESERVED_MASK 0x0600 /* reserved bits in ip6f_offlg */
+# define IP6F_MORE_FRAG 0x0100 /* more-fragments flag */
+#endif
+
+/* IPv6 options */
+struct ip6_opt
+ {
+ uint8_t ip6o_type;
+ uint8_t ip6o_len;
+ };
+
+/* The high-order 3 bits of the option type define the behavior
+ * when processing an unknown option and whether or not the option
+ * content changes in flight.
+ */
+#define IP6OPT_TYPE(o) ((o) & 0xc0)
+#define IP6OPT_TYPE_SKIP 0x00
+#define IP6OPT_TYPE_DISCARD 0x40
+#define IP6OPT_TYPE_FORCEICMP 0x80
+#define IP6OPT_TYPE_ICMP 0xc0
+#define IP6OPT_TYPE_MUTABLE 0x20
+
+/* Special option types for padding. */
+#define IP6OPT_PAD1 0
+#define IP6OPT_PADN 1
+
+#define IP6OPT_JUMBO 0xc2
+#define IP6OPT_NSAP_ADDR 0xc3
+#define IP6OPT_TUNNEL_LIMIT 0x04
+#define IP6OPT_ROUTER_ALERT 0x05
+
+/* Jumbo Payload Option */
+struct ip6_opt_jumbo
+ {
+ uint8_t ip6oj_type;
+ uint8_t ip6oj_len;
+ uint8_t ip6oj_jumbo_len[4];
+ };
+#define IP6OPT_JUMBO_LEN 6
+
+/* NSAP Address Option */
+struct ip6_opt_nsap
+ {
+ uint8_t ip6on_type;
+ uint8_t ip6on_len;
+ uint8_t ip6on_src_nsap_len;
+ uint8_t ip6on_dst_nsap_len;
+ /* followed by source NSAP */
+ /* followed by destination NSAP */
+ };
+
+/* Tunnel Limit Option */
+struct ip6_opt_tunnel
+ {
+ uint8_t ip6ot_type;
+ uint8_t ip6ot_len;
+ uint8_t ip6ot_encap_limit;
+ };
+
+/* Router Alert Option */
+struct ip6_opt_router
+ {
+ uint8_t ip6or_type;
+ uint8_t ip6or_len;
+ uint8_t ip6or_value[2];
+ };
+
+/* Router alert values (in network byte order) */
+#if __BYTE_ORDER == __BIG_ENDIAN
+# define IP6_ALERT_MLD 0x0000
+# define IP6_ALERT_RSVP 0x0001
+# define IP6_ALERT_AN 0x0002
+#else /* __BYTE_ORDER == __LITTLE_ENDIAN */
+# define IP6_ALERT_MLD 0x0000
+# define IP6_ALERT_RSVP 0x0100
+# define IP6_ALERT_AN 0x0200
+#endif
+
+#endif /* netinet/ip6.h */
